John A. Logan College invites applications for the position of Chief Information Technology Officer. John A. Logan is acomprehensive community college located in Carterville, Illinois. The college, nationally recognized for outstanding faculty, staff,programs and facilities, serves the Illinois Community College District #530. The college's annual budget is approximately $60 million. Thecollege serves a diverse region of communities within the college's district serving a population of approximately 143,479. John A. LoganCollege is an established, growing, and innovative higher education institution. The College serves over 6,200 credit-hour studentsthroughout its 1,192 square mile district. Carterville is located in southern Illinois and is within ten minutes of a major university andwithin two hours of St. Louis, MO. John A. Logan College is seeking a Chief Information Technology Officer to provide leadership,planning, coordination and direction of the College's administrative, academic, and infrastructure technology resources. The ChiefInformation Technology Officer will work with the executive management team, departmental stakeholders, the Integrated Technology Committee,faculty, staff and students to ensure excellence and integrity in identifying, recommending, implementing, and supporting technologysolutions to achieve business and academic goals. Reporting to the Vice-President of Business Services and College Facilities, the positionwill participate in strategic and operational governance processes of the College and supervise a staff of IT professional and studentworkers by providing operational planning, prioritization, and direction. The candidate must possess exemplary leadership qualities,experience and a proven history of success in guiding technology organizations to achieve objectives. The candidate should demonstrateexperience and a best practice approach to strategic planning, governance, organizational development, project and change management, and akeen understanding of business processes and operations essential for successful stewardship of a complex organization in a fast-pacedenvironment.A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, or related field is required (Master's degree in thesefields or Business Administration with technology as a core component preferred) and demonstrate a minimum of five (5) years ofprogressively responsible experience in managing and/or directing an IT organization is required (community college or higher educationenvironment preferred).
